    On the occasion of testifying to his cruelty in pursuit of a divorce Mrs. Julia Fitzsimmons:

    "He used to go away and be brought back intoxicated later by some friends."

    The cause of their final separation:

    "We had a quarrel about his drinking, because he refused to quit. I had not been speaking to him. When I passed by the door, he kicked me."

    The article in the El Paso Herald also claimed that additional witnesses had seen Fitz strangle his Mrs as well as pull her hair, and that he also used to "throw bottles at her."

    She sounds like a pretty quality lady actually. All she wanted was to legally revert back to her old name: "I don't want alimony. I worked before and I can do it again."

    Fitz did ,one with his first wife a boy called Charles,three with his second wife ,Robert, Martin ,and Rosalie ,none with Julia the wife in question.Fitz remarried after divorcing Julia he was married four times in all.
    Fitz and Fitz Jnr ,they gave exhibitions together .
    Fitz Jnr had a stab at boxing ,but was not really all that successful.
